News Future Frames screenings begin this afternoon.

Published: July 03, 2023| 11:35 AM

The Future Frames programme aims to support up-and-coming European directors.  
 
Each year, the KVIFF’s programme team selects 10 students and film school graduates, recommended
by the European Film Promotion member organisations, to present their short and medium-length
films to the festival audience. Graduates of the programme include Michal Blaško (feature film Victim;
world premiere at the Venice Film Festival 2022), Hleb Papou (feature film The Legionnaire; Best
Emerging Director Award at the Locarno IFF 2021) and Tadeusz Łysiak (short film The Dress, Oscar
nomination 2020). 
 
The Future Frames: Generation NEXT of European Cinema programme, organised by European Film
Promotion and Karlovy Vary IFF, helps talented European directors kickstart their careers. By
partnering with Allwyn, the world’s leading lottery operator, and thanks to co-operation with the
United Talent Agency and Range Media Partners, Future Frames is now significantly expanding the
range of opportunities it offers to young filmmakers.
